Southern New Mexico’s cannabis market operates differently from Albuquerque’s. The proximity to El Paso — where cannabis remains illegal in Texas as of 2026 — creates a steady stream of cross-border shoppers who make the trip specifically because they can’t buy at home. It’s a market shaped by geography as much as local demand.
Las Cruces itself is New Mexico’s second-largest city, home to New Mexico State University and Doña Ana County, which covers a wide swath of southern New Mexico. Las Cruces as a Destination: What Else Is Worth Your Time
If you’re coming from El Paso or passing through on I-10, Las Cruces is worth more than a quick dispensary stop. Southern New Mexico has some of the most dramatic and accessible outdoor scenery in the Southwest.
- Organ Mountains–Desert Peaks National Monument — Stunning granite peaks just east of Las Cruces. Exceptional hiking, dramatic views, and a range of trail difficulty levels. One of the most visually impressive landscapes in the region. (nofollow reference)
- Old Mesilla Plaza — Historic village just south of downtown Las Cruces with local shops, restaurants, and Southwestern architecture. A quieter, more local alternative to Albuquerque’s Old Town.
- New Mexico Farm & Ranch Heritage Museum — A genuinely interesting museum covering the agricultural history of the state, with live animals, demonstrations, and exhibitions on New Mexico’s farming and ranching traditions.
- Downtown Las Cruces Farmers & Crafts Market — Every Wednesday and Saturday, the downtown pedestrian mall hosts local food vendors, artisans, and musicians. One of the best farmers markets in southern NM.
- Dripping Springs Natural Area — A scenic canyon hike with water features just east of the city — accessible in about 20 minutes from downtown Las Cruces.

For El Paso Residents and Texas Visitors: What You Need to Know
Texas has not legalized recreational cannabis as of 2026. That makes Score 420 Las Cruces — sitting just across the state line — a popular destination for El Paso residents making the trip specifically to purchase cannabis legally.
A few things worth knowing if you’re coming from Texas:
- You can legally purchase cannabis at Score 420 Las Cruces with a valid out-of-state ID showing you are 21 or older.
- You cannot transport cannabis across the New Mexico–Texas state line. This is a federal offense regardless of the direction of travel or the legal status in either state.
- Cannabis purchased in New Mexico must be consumed in New Mexico.

What is the purchase limit at Las Cruces?
New Mexico law allows adults 21+ to purchase up to 2 ounces of flower, 16 grams of extract, or 800mg of edibles per transaction. These limits apply at the drive-through as well as in-store.
